The world’s highest-altitude photovoltaic project achieves grid-connected energy storage
The second phase of the Huadian Tibet Caipeng SolarStorage Power Station has commenced operation at an altitude of 5,228 meters. It features 250,000 photovoltaic panels with a total installed capacity of 100,000 kilowatts, and receives annual average solar radiation more than double that of plain areas at the same latitude. Once operational, the second phase is expected to generate 155 million kilowatt-hours of electricity annually, meeting the electricity needs of 50,000 households and reducing carbon dioxide emissions by 101,800 tons annually. The project utilizes next-generation bifacial solar panels, increasing power generation efficiency by 7.5%. The energy storage system, comprised of 16 white boxes, acts like a giant “power bank,” storing electricity during the day and delivering it at night, ensuring grid stability and security and serving as a model for clean energy utilization in high-altitude areas.
“Sunshine Passbook” illuminates Yanjiang Village
Yanjiang Village in Xincheng Town, Yizheng City, Yangzhou, Jiangsu Province, a national permanent farmland conservation area, began its green energy transformation in 2024. On December 25, 2023, Jiangsu Province’s first energy cooperative, the Yizheng Xuzhong Energy Cooperative, was established. Villager Liu Hongxi installed 72 solar photovoltaic panels and received an initial installation fee of 14,400 yuan. He also received 50 yuan in rental income per panel every quarter, bringing his annual income to over 10,000 yuan. To date, the cooperative has 103 participating households, with an installed capacity of 2.8 megawatts, generating over 1 million yuan in cumulative revenue for the villagers. The cooperative plans to increase its installed capacity to 4 megawatts by 2025, benefiting even more  villagers.
Chris’s Journey to Lowering Electricity Bills
Chris used to pay around $700 per month for PG&E electricity. After installing his new solar system, those high bills are now a thing of the past. His average monthly electricity bill is now around $50. Over the next 25 years, Chris expects to save nearly $500,000. The solar system has significantly reduced his electricity bill, significantly lowered his cost of living, and generated substantial long-term financial  benefits.
Dorina’s solar energy savings
Dorina and her family, living in Bristol, signed up for Sunsave Plus to install solar panels in March 2025. Since installation, they’ve saved approximately £50 on their monthly energy bills (after deducting the Sunsave Plus fee). Over the next 20 years, they estimate this will translate to approximately £30,000 in savings. Choosing solar panels not only reduces long-term costs and protects against inflation, but also improves their home’s EPC rating and value. Sunsave offers a 20-year, fixed price contract that covers installation, maintenance, inverter and battery replacement, giving Dorina and her family peace of mind.
Skyworth Photovoltaic’s “Yang Lao Jin” opens a new chapter in rural financial management
Skyworth Solar has launched the “Yang Lao Jin” household photovoltaic solution for the rural market. For example, a 150 square meter rooftop in Jiangsu province can invest in a photovoltaic power station, generating its own electricity for its own use, achieving a payback period of as little as 2.2 years. Compared to depositing 100,000 yuan in a bank over 30 years, which would yield less than 30,000 yuan, a 30 year investment in a “Yang Lao Jin” power station would yield over one million yuan. Skyworth Solar utilizes drone 3D modeling, customized solutions from a Class A design institute, and a professional operations and maintenance team to achieve intelligent management throughout the entire process, allowing farmers to easily enjoy the benefits of green energy and providing a new avenue for rural elderly care and financial   management.
PISEN Electronics’ green energy-saving practices
Sichuan Pisheng Electronics Co., Ltd. utilized idle rooftop resources to construct a distributed photovoltaic power generation project in June 2024. Over the past year, the project has generated 1.45 million kWh of electricity, with the company using 1 million kWh for its own use and 450,000 kWh of surplus electricity connected to the grid. Furthermore, the company leveraged its technological advantages to develop a “super charger”an integrated industrial and commercial energy storage cabinet that stores photovoltaic power and can be flexibly allocated based on electricity demand. Comprehensive estimates show that the combination of photovoltaics and energy storage saves the company approximately 920,000 yuan in annual electricity bills, establishing a sustainable development path that reduces energy consumption, reduces emissions, and improves  profitability.
